Chikkamagaluru / Kannur: Two Maoists from Karnataka desired since 2005 and arrested on Tuesday was sent to the trial detention by the Thalassery court in Kerala.
Underground Maois, BG Krishnamurthy and Savithri, who have several cases against them in Karnataka, Kerala and Tamil Nadu are arrested on Tuesday near Madhur Forest Checkpost on the Gundlupet-Gundlupet Sulthan route.
On Wednesday, they were produced before the District Court in Thalastsery under strict security and returned in court detention until December 9.
The duo was then transferred to Viyur’s center prison.
in Thrissur.
According to sources, Krishnamurthy is the Secretary of the West Ghats Zonal Committee.
Both were being hunted since February 2005 after the Maoist leader Saketh Rajan was shot in the numbers in Chikkamagaluru, said the source.
More than 50 cases were postponed with 42-year-old Krishnamurthy in Chikkamagaluru Regency, Shivamogga, Udupi and Dakshina Kannada.
More than 22 cases delayed against 36-year-old Savithri, according to sources.
Krishnamurthy and Savithri face accusations to spread Maois ideology, have weapons, weapons training and assembly that violate the law with the intention to launch armed agitation.
Krishnamurthy, known as BGK among Maois, was born in Nemmaru Village in Sringeri Taluk.
He became the leader for the Special Region Committee Western Maoist Ghats.
Savithri comes from the village of Mavinakere in Kalasa Taluk and is associated with Kabani Dalam, which is active in Karnataka and Kerala, especially in Wayanad.
Krishnamurthy studied Ba LLB in Shivamogga.
He was interested in the ideology of Maois from his studies and joined agitation to save Kudremukh forest in Chikkamagaluru.
Even when his father Gopallaiah died of cancer in 2018, Krishnamurthy did not visit the family, believed, even though the body was stored for two days for him.
Savithiri is a former wife of one time Maois Vikram Gowda.
They divorced a few years ago.
He left the Malnad district for Wayanad a decade back.
